Sleep influences epilepsy, with non-rapid eye movement sleep activating discharges and rapid eye movement sleep having an anticonvulsive effect. Sleep deprivation EEG aids epilepsy diagnosis when other tests are inconclusive.

Area of Science:

  • Neurology
  • Sleep Medicine
  • Epileptology

Context:

  • Epileptiform discharge frequency varies significantly within individuals.
  • Sleep-wake cycles and specific sleep stages modulate epileptic activity.

Purpose:

  • To elucidate the relationship between sleep stages and epileptiform discharges.
  • To highlight the diagnostic utility of sleep electroencephalography (EEG) in epilepsy.

Summary:

  • Generalized seizures are activated during non-rapid eye movement (NREM) sleep, while partial seizures show complex sleep state correlations.
  • Sleep stages I and II, and transitional stages, generally enhance discharges.
  • Rapid eye movement (REM) sleep exhibits an anticonvulsive effect and can focalize paroxysmal activity.
  • Sleep EEG aids in localizing seizure foci, particularly in temporal lobe epilepsy, and differentiates epileptic from non-epileptic seizures.
